In Egypt what would be thought to be a road hazard everywhere else in the world is probably the street. Exterior of Cairo there are few defined spaces for site visitors and pedestrians. Even in which there are pavements individuals, cars and animals reveal equal accessibility.

Most guests suspect leaving the sanctuary of their hotels pitfalls becoming flown home in a box. But as Egyptian street life is gloriously vibrant it looks a shame to skip out when all that's essential is a tiny nearby expertise.

Walk like an Egyptian: This is less complicated than you might consider. Wear shoes with traction and keep looking over your shoulder to check out what's heading on behind, even when walking on what appears to be a 'safe' aspect of the road. There is not one. Pot holes without having safety barriers regularly show up overnight, so glancing down sometimes aids to avert undesired tumbles.

Jay strolling: Is entirely legal, encouraged even. Nevertheless if you can prevent crossing the streets, do - you will dwell longer. If you need to cross then operate as rapidly as you can in a zigzag fashion while keeping a constant watch on anything at all that's moving or could perhaps transfer. In no way presume somebody will quit for you. They won't. For genuinely occupied locations it's much better to uncover a place wherever locals are previously crossing and tailgate them as nonchalantly as achievable. Suspected stalkers are as unwelcome in Egypt as they are elsewhere.

Don't forget there's an additional way to cope with this. A single can both hop on a nearby mini-bus or consider a taxi.

Mini-Bus: Multitudes of honking mini-buses careening to a cease in front of pedestrians will consider you wherever along fixed routes within towns and cities really cheaply. By cheap, I indicate never ever shell out much more than one / two LE (Egyptian kilos). Ignore any attempts at bargaining. Buses are small and often crowded, so obtaining in and out can reveala lot more flesh than is regarded as appropriate and can lead to unwelcome attentions. Modest attire is for that reason to be suggested.

Taxis: Collective service taxis are one particular of the best capabilities of Egyptian transport. They run on a wide assortment of versatile routes and are more quickly than buses. Taxis can be used for specific trips or shared with other people. Rates for all journeys, like intercity, must be agreed in advance. On the downside is the often maniacal driving at high speed.

Alternatively, if you have a death want, you can hire a auto.

Automobile rentals: A range of international companies operate in Egypt. To retain a vehicle you require a valid worldwide driving license, be at least 25 years of age and possess nerves of metal.

Rules of the Road: There are none. But nevertheless it is important to have your facts straight just before attempting to pilot anything at all on wheels. For instance driving is accomplished by continuously blasting horns and flashing headlights - a approach known locally as 'The Egyptian Brake Pedal'.

Honking: Is completed to signal intentions and warnings when, for illustration, anything at all is blocking the street, something seems to be like it might, some thing isn't and at traffic lights irregardless of color. Drivers toot when pulling out, pulling in, stopping, transferring, bored or when saying hi there.

Lights: Indicators are reserved for use solely at evening and then only to alert any following targeted traffic of road bends in advance. In darkness headlights are flashed intermittently to oncoming traffic to alert them of their presence fairly than utilised continuously. Saves on the battery apparently.

It's sensible in no way to presume any human or animal has witnessed you - honk that horn and flash those lights even if it's just to be pleasant!

Lane Markings: Are purely ornamental. Drivers generate on which ever facet of the road appeals, whichis typically on your facet. The intentions of one more street-user need to never ever be taken for granted as there's a good opportunity he hasn't made a decision nevertheless and, even if has, he'll almost definitely alter his mind yet again.

Overtaking: Automobiles, buses, carts and trucks will make each hard work to overtake and undertake other cars even in what appears to be an impossibly tight space, as this gives them the appropriate of way. Anybody who tries cutting in from behind is ignored as they're liable for collisions.

Collisions: If you do have an accident, instantly go on the offensive and give to shell out for repairs. The option is getting screamed at until finally you're deaf and you'll still stop up having to pay. If the neighborhood police take place to be about, regular procedure is to chuck everyone in prison regardless of fault and, feel me, you are going to even now end up paying out.

Speeding: Strangely speed limits are rigidly enforced inEgypt. Though you wouldn't consider so from the way Egyptians drive. Even minimal infringements can result in confiscation of one's driving license. Acquiring it returned is an expensive, protracted and laborious company with no ensure of accomplishment even if one particular hands about wads of difficult income ie. bucks or euros.

Security: One safety characteristic you can usually count on while cruising the Egyptian highways and byways is the street block. To some they seem like an needless hindrance and the unlimited waiting to be judged buddy or foe interminable. Be affected person and remember the extended you wait, the lengthier you stay.

Cultural suggestion for better appreciating the previously mentioned: The Islamic religion is a critical component in Egyptian existence. Consequently, this is a fatalistic culture and one's destiny is considered to be firmly in the fingers of God. Given that absolutely nothing can be done about this, there tends to be an acceptance of the status quo. In other phrases, the reply to anything is subject matter to 'Insha'allah' (God willing) and a duplicate of the Koran is a standard added in all types of transportation. On the upside, this fatalism implies that it's uncommon to meet an Egyptian who's not smiling.

Obtaining close to Egypt: Egyptian public transport is surprisingly effective and affordable.

Bus: Inter-metropolis buses are the lowest priced way to travel around the region. A ticket from Hurghada to Cairo fees as little as 60 LE per person, a single way. In the Red Sea area you will discover two principal operators - The Upper Egypt Bus Firm serves the Red Sea Governorate towns, from Hurghada to Safaga, El Quseir and Marsa Alam, also linking these cities to the Nile valley and Cairo. The Canal Zone and Sinai are served by the East Delta Bus Company. The two businesses offer air-conditioned buses and on the longer routes they also have on-board toilets. Schedules modify routinely, so it is greater to verify personally at the bus terminals.

Rail: A bit much more costly is the substantial railway network managed by Egyptian State Railways. The network has a high common of support and addresses the entire nation, connecting all the primary metropolitan areas. Tickets can be purchased at the station but, as with all matters in Egypt, some persistence is essential to actually complete the purchase.
